Pinterest is upgrading its shopping capabilities with updates to its existing features and launching a new shopping tab. It is releasing new ways to shop from boards, pins and search results.
New Shopping Features
Shop From Pin Boards
A new ‘Shop’ tab is available for users on their own boards. Users can go on to their fashion boards and can browse products available on that board after clicking on the shop tab. This new feature works with home decor and fashion products. It will only display products that are in stock.

Shop From Search Results
A new Shop tab will be displayed in the Pinterest search results. It will help users to shop for products when searching for terms like summer outfits, home decor or kitchen models. Users will be able to filter search results when looking for something more specific along with a new feature to sort search results by price.
Shop From Pins
The Pinterest existing visual search feature is now updated with shopping capabilities. The visual search feature helps users to look for products by taking a picture or posting an image. Pinterest then displays relevant pins with that product in it. Now users will be able to see a new shop option when performing a visual search.
Shop On Pinterest From Anywhere
With the introduction of these upgrades, Pinterest is making the platform as a social network for shopping- a platform where users can buy products they see on the screen. Hence creating a call to action by allowing users to shop from any screen they look at. Whether it be their own boards, search results or shopping boards.
Not only it is useful for users, but it is also beneficial for retailers. Businesses of any size can benefit from these upgrades as most of the searches on Pinterest are unbranded. Pinterest data reveals that users search for generic terms rather than searching for a brand specifically.
Shopping Searches On Pinterest That Are Trending
Pinterest has come out with these new updates at a time when almost all the users are at home spending more time on their devices. Searches for support to small businesses are on the rise as noted by Pinterest with people searching for ‘help small businesses’ lately comparatively more than the last few weeks. Many searches include people looking out for ways to set up their new work from home office setups.
Pinterest Shopping Statistics
Pinterest has seen a significant increase in the user engagements with shopping on Pinterest by 44% from last year. More than 70% of users have purchased products displayed in pins by brands. Users are 3 times more likely to visit the retailer’s site after looking for it on Pinterest compared to any other social media platform.
